    Re: GPS Accuracy Now.
    From: Jim Easton
    Date: 2000 May 02, 23:00 EDT

    Just to remind the group that Germany has implemented
    a very successful system transmitting GPS corrections
    via LORAN. This has the advantages of being cheap,
    redundant and very accurate. Probably precisely
    why the FAA has thrown millions of useless dollars
    at WAAS -- something that was provably crippled
    in its very concept.
